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10621038250 5265334 4498259 997681381 935862
64683559 16581846130 45
64683559 16581846130 45
58 2941 893853656
All about undefined
Interested in learning more?
64683559 16581846130 45
58 2941 893853656
See more
78224591464 8519476
26 2783259 90086748392
See more
922441 47750 67773
604789774 0861055 777722 4852451990
See more